Summary

Join a family-owned business with a proud 155-year heritage of delivering iconic building and civil engineering projects across the UK. As a Section Engineer, you will be a senior member of the project team reporting to the Chief Engineer. Your primary responsibility will be to oversee the design, coordination, and leadership of multiple subcontractors across various trades, initially focusing on the building envelope before transitioning to fit-out packages.

This role requires close collaboration with internal departments and external stakeholders including architects, engineers, subcontractors, and client agents. You will manage and review numerous work packages, including tender information produced by design teams, ensuring compliance with contract requirements and quality standards.

You will be expected to promote a culture of safety leadership, maintain high standards of workmanship, and ensure timely delivery within budget. Experience in managing multi-million-pound construction projects and multiple engineering or trade packages is essential. Experience in healthcare projects and carrying out the Lift Supervisor role with an A62 card is advantageous.
